Today marks 11 months since the Russian army began a full scale invasion of Ukraine, with an attempt to take the capital of Kyiv, as well as the Donbass & Kharkov in the east, Sumy and Chernihiv in the northeast and the entire sea coast in the south. Since then the Russian "special military operation" has brought suffering to people in both Ukraine and Russia, as well as many others around the world who have felt the indirect effects of the conflict, such as higher prices for food and energy.

[update Thursday, 26 January] Yet another wave of Russian missiles was fired at Ukraine...
Ukrenergo, Ukraine's state-run energy operator, has said Thursday's Russian missile strikes resulted in “substantial damage” to the power grid. Russia launched 70 missiles at Ukraine on Thursday, 47 of which were intercepted, the Ukrainian Armed Forces said in its daily operational update on Facebook, and Moscow's forces also carried out 44 airstrikes, including 18 using Iranian-made Shahed-136 drones. [from CNN here]
Several of Ukraine’s regions have to implement emergency power cuts because of outages caused by Russia’s wave of attacks on Thursday, Ukrainian state news channel Suspilne reported. [from CNBC here]
Ukrenergo, Ukraine's state-run energy operator, said that Ukraine had now suffered 13 missile attacks and 15 drone attacks on its energy facilities. [from here]
